Limits On Compensatory & Punitive Damages
For employers with: Limits
15-100 employees $50,000
101-200 employees $100,000
201-500 employees $200,000
500 employees $300,000
Punitive damages are available only
• where the respondent acted with "malice or with reckless indifference to the federally protected rights of an aggrieved individual."
Source: EEOC.gov

5 “Don’ts” That Hurt Your Damage Claim
Don’t #1
Don’t stop looking for a new job.
The law requires you make efforts to “mitigate” or lessen your damages by
looking for other work.
It shows the jury that you are making efforts to move forward with your life
and not sitting and waiting for a paycheck from them.

Make sure you keep track of all of your efforts to find work such as date applied, name of employer, and
response, if any.

Don’t #2
Do not post things about your lawsuit on social media (text messages, emails).
The employer’s lawyer is entitled to all of this information and will ask for it
during the lawsuit.
If you have put something silly in writing, rest assured that the jury will
see that as well.
Richard Celler Legal, P.A.
Don’t #3
Do not lie on your tax returns, unemployment documents, or other
government submissions.
Juries look for reasons NOT to award damages to employment litigants, and
one of the easiest ways to hurt your claim is to lie on your tax return or other
sworn documents.
Don’t #4
Don’t spend more than you have.
Be smart with your money and don’t count on a lawsuit as your savior. Until you have your jury award in your hand,
anything can happen.

Don’t #5
Don’t be frivolous with your damage claims.
If you have been wrongfully terminated and you are pursuing a claim for
damages…
Keep a written tally of the damages you have suffered from loss of 401k to
unable to pay your mortgage, to credit card debt (along with the invoices and documents supporting the claim), and
present this to your lawyer on a regular basis.
